## Data Stores — Validata Plugin System

Validata loads validator plugins at startup from the registry table; each plugin declares a schema version and target dataset. Failed validations land in the quarantine store, reviewed weekly. Plugin metadata and run history share one instance, sized for roughly 10k runs per day. For the eng sync demo environment, connect with the string below.

replica DSN, fadup-yagug: mssql://rusox_svc:0K2wrVJefbkR2n@db-53b3.qirvangrid.example:5432/istix

Alert: DocSentry lint failure rate above threshold. This fires when the Marrowfield documentation linter rejects more than 20% of merged pages in a rolling hour, usually indicating a broken style-rule deploy rather than genuinely bad docs. First step: check whether a new rule pack shipped recently and roll it back if so. Otherwise, sample the failing pages and confirm the errors are real. Triage steps, rule pack history, and rollback commands are collected on the internal page.

wiki page, hadup-taduf: https://jira.tolvaqlabs.internal/projects/display/display/b675c5ba

Handover Note — Budget Request (Thornfield Expansion)

Hi all — as I hand over to Maren Oltby, a quick word on the pending budget request. The Thornfield site expansion needs sign-off before month-end or we lose the contractor slot. I've pre-cleared the figures with Greywick Finance; Maren just needs to push it through committee. Context on the wider plan sits below.

management briefing: Project Ulavan slips by two quarters because of the staffing delay.